1. What are the different types of leather?

There are few different types of leather: Full-grain: the strongest and most durable leather used in many heavy-duty products Top-grain: more pliable and thinner than full-grain leather Suede: what's left behind after the top grain leather has been split away from the hide - that's why it has the fuzzy feeling Bicast: split leather backing covered with an embossed layer of polyurethane or vinyl-like those glossy shoes you see Bonded: a mix of faux and real leather

3. Is Italian leather the best? And what is vegetable tanning?

Unlike other methods of leather tanning which rely on heavy use of chemicals, Italian leather artisans use only natural plant-based extracts during manufacturing. Raw hides undergo treatment in large wooden drums where they are cleansed of salts and impurities. They are then tanned with vegetable extracts and natural tannins, extracted from trees and logs that give the leather its unique characteristics. The leather is then dried to remove excess moisture before it can be crafted into the goods you know and love.

4. What are the benefits of vegetable tanning?

The use of natural ingredients in the vegetable tanning process has three main benefits: The process results in leather that is built to last. It is softer, more flexible, and more durable than other leathers on the market. The leather has a distinct, timeless appearance. Because it relies on natural ingredients and the care of the leather artisans, no two hides look exactly alike. The marks that you find on the leather are not imperfections but unique features of each batch of leather made. It is super easy to care for. Simply wipe the surface with a damp cloth and dry it with a clean cloth.
